Find the area of the regular 20​-gon with radius 77 mm.

Respuesta :

wolf1728
wolf1728 wolf1728
  • 03-06-2017
The area of a polygon equals
area = circumradius² * number of sides * sin (360 / # of sides) / 2
area = 77² * 20 * sin (360 / 20) / 2
area = 77² * 20 * sin (18) / 2
area = 118,580 * 0.30902 / 2
area = 36,643.59 / 2
area = 18,321.8 square millimeters
